Note
There is no separate Alarm button. Pressing any key on the front
panel resets alarm output, including the internal buzzer when the
alarm is activated. However, when you are in the menu or PTZ
mode, you must exit the menu or PTZ mode first to reset the
alarm output.

The POWER LED is lit when the DVR is On.
The ALARM LED is lit when alarm output or internal buzzer is activated.
The REC LED is lit when the DVR is recording. When the DVR is in Panic recording
mode, the REC LED flickers.
The NETWORK LED is lit when the unit is networked, either via Ethernet or modem.
The COPY LED is lit when data is being copied using the internal CD-RW or the
USB port.

Function in PTZ mode:
Press CAMERA 1 to zoom in in PTZ mode.
Press CAMERA 2 to zoom out in PTZ mode.
Press CAMERA 3 to control near focus of the PTZ camera in PTZ mode.
Press CAMERA 4 to control far focus of the PTZ camera in PTZ mode.
